Title: 以太坊钱包开发全过程详解视频

                <del draggable="p37ym2"></del><center dropzone="7xy4wm"></center><address lang="ybujtj"></address><tt dir="nnsm6e"></tt><abbr dropzone="91nlly"></abbr><dl lang="qlj4cc"></dl><strong id="glq4cm"></strong><strong lang="4te25i"></strong><acronym dir="98hzya"></acronym><noframes id="g_q4e6">
                发布时间:2025-02-08 21:39:24
                内容主体大纲: 1. 介绍以太坊及其钱包的重要性 - 什么是以太坊 - 以太坊钱包的基本功能和重要性 2. 以太坊钱包的类型 - 热钱包 - 冷钱包 - 硬件钱包 - 移动钱包 3. 钱包开发的基本知识 - 区块链基础 - 智能合约的概念和应用 4. 开发工具和环境准备 - 必备工具(程序语言、框架、库等) - 环境搭建(IDE、测试网) 5. 实际开发过程 - 钱包的用户界面设计 - 钱包核心功能实现 - 钱包的安全性考虑 6. 钱包测试与部署 - 钱包的测试方法 - 上线及后期维护 7. 可能遇到的问题及解决方案 - 常见问题汇总 - 调试与技巧 8. 视频展示与总结 - 关键步骤视频演示 - 最后总结与展望 相关问题及详细介绍:

                1. 什么是以太坊及其钱包的重要性?

                以太坊是一种开源的区块链平台,它允许开发者在其上构建和发布去中心化的应用程序(dApps)。与比特币不同,以太坊不仅仅是一种数字货币,它的核心是智能合约,这些合同是自动执行的,具有高度的安全性和透明度。

                以太坊钱包则是用户存储和管理以太币(ETH)和其他基于以太坊区块链的代币(如ERC-20代币)的工具。它的主要功能包括发送和接收以太币、查询交易记录,以及与智能合约交互。由于其去中心化特性,它为用户提供了更高的安全性和对资产的控制。

                总体而言,以太坊钱包是参与以太坊生态系统的必备工具,掌握其使用和开发是理解区块链技术的重要一步。

                2. 以太坊钱包的类型有哪些?

                Title: 以太坊钱包开发全过程详解视频

                以太坊钱包主要可以分为热钱包和冷钱包。

                热钱包通常是在线的钱包,可以方便快捷地进行交易,但其安全性较低。典型的热钱包包括在线服务、桌面应用程序等。用户可以随时随地访问资金,非常适合常规交易。

                冷钱包是一种离线存储方式,安全性更高,适合长期存储数字资产。硬件钱包(如Ledger、Trezor)和纸钱包都是冷钱包的形式。它们通常不连接到互联网,保护用户的私钥不被外界攻击。

                此外,还有硬件钱包,这种形式的安全性和便利性兼具。移动钱包则专注于提供移动设备上的便捷访问,适合随身携带和快速交易。

                3. 钱包开发的基本知识是什么?

                开发以太坊钱包需要理解区块链的基础结构。区块链是一个去中心化的数据库,其数据结构为区块和链。每一个区块包含一组交易记录。

                智能合约则是以太坊的核心,它是一种存储在以太坊区块链上并可以自动执行的合约。开发者需要编写合约的代码来定义合约的规则和行为,这些合约在满足特定条件时将自动执行。

                了解这些基础知识对于钱包开发至关重要,它们将帮助开发者理解如何与以太坊网络交互以及如何处理交易。

                4. 开发工具和环境如何准备?

                Title: 以太坊钱包开发全过程详解视频

                开发以太坊钱包需要一些必要的工具和框架。常用的编程语言包括JavaScript、Python、Java等,而Ethereum提供了多种开发工具,如Truffle、Ganache等,可以简化现在开发过程。

                搭建开发环境时,首先需要安装Node.js和npm,这是JavaScript的运行环境和包管理工具。然后,可以在链上搭建测试环境(如使用Rinkeby或Ropsten测试网),以验证钱包的功能。

                为了提高开发效率,集成开发环境(如Visual Studio Code、Remix等)也非常重要,这些工具能够帮助开发者更便捷地编写和调试代码。

                5. 实际开发过程中需要注意什么?

                实际开发以太坊钱包时,界面设计应当注重用户体验,确保用户能够方便地进行操作。同时,钱包的核心功能,包括创建钱包、导入钱包、发送接收以太币等,都需要严谨而有效地实现。

                安全性是钱包开发的重要考量,需要采用多种方式来保护用户资产,包括加密私钥、实现多重签名等。此外,使用第三方库来处理加密和解密操作也是一个好主意,以减少因为代码不当造成的安全隐患。

                6. 钱包测试与部署过程中面临哪些挑战?

                在钱包测试时,首先要确保所有功能正常工作,包括创建钱包、发起和接收交易、显示交易记录等。测试过程中需找出、安全和性能问题,并及时进行修复。使用以太坊测试网络可以避免真实以太币的风险,同时进行功能验证。

                一旦功能测试完成,就需要进行最终的部署。在上线期间,需要对钱包进行负载测试,确保在高并发情况下也能正常工作。此外,后期维护也非常重要,定期更新和中断问题的修复必须及时跟进,以提升用户体验。

                结合这些问题及其详细介绍,为用户提供了全方位的信息与指导,帮助他们在以太坊钱包的开发过程中避免常见误区并实现高效开发。
                分享 :
                                        author

                                        tpwallet

                                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  2023年以太坊公链钱包价格
                                                  2024-12-23
                                                  2023年以太坊公链钱包价格

                                                  ### 内容主体大纲1. **引言** - 简述以太坊的背景 - 钱包在数字货币市场中的重要性2. **以太坊公链钱包概述** - 定义和...

                                                  比特币钱包支付私钥的安
                                                  2024-12-29
                                                  比特币钱包支付私钥的安

                                                  ## 内容主体大纲1. 引言 - 比特币及其重要性 - 钱包与私钥的概述2. 比特币钱包的种类 - 线上钱包 - 离线钱包 - 硬件钱...

                                                  比特币钱包的功能解析:
                                                  2025-01-03
                                                  比特币钱包的功能解析:

                                                  ---### 内容主体大纲1. **引言** - 简要介绍比特币及其钱包的概念。 - 阐述本文目标:分析比特币钱包的买卖功能。2....

                                                  标题如何选择最适合存储
                                                  2024-11-06
                                                  标题如何选择最适合存储

                                                  内容主体大纲 1. 引言2. XRP简介 - 什么是XRP - XRP的特性与用途3. 存储XRP的必要性 - 为什么需要专门的钱包 - 热钱包与冷...